To begin, wash the oranges with cool running water. Using a sharp knife, cut off each end of the oranges and slice each one in half. Insert the citrus juicer or reamer into the center of each orange half and press down firmly to extract all of the juice. Once all of the juice has been extracted, pour it through a fine mesh strainer into a glass pitcher or other container to remove any pulp and seeds from the juice. Serve your homemade fresh squeezed orange juice immediately or store it in an air-tight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Enjoy!

What is an Operating System?
An operating system (OS) is a set of software that manages computer hardware and provides services for programs. It allows users to interact with the computer, running applications, managing memory, and controlling peripherals such as printers and scanners. Operating systems also provide a platform for application software to run on. Examples of popular operating systems include Microsoft Windows, macOS, Linux, and Android.
Features of an Operating System
Operating systems have many features that make them useful for everyday computing. These features include multitasking, which allows multiple programs to run at the same time; virtual memory, which allows programs to use more memory than is physically available; device drivers, which allow hardware devices to communicate with the operating system; and graphical user interface (GUI), which allows users to interact with the system using icons, windows, and menus. Other features include security measures such as firewalls and antivirus protection; networking capabilities; support for peripheral devices such as printers and scanners; and file management tools such as search capabilities and file compression utilities.
Types of Operating Systems
There are several different types of operating systems available today. The most common are desktop or laptop-based operating systems such as Windows 10 or macOS. Mobile operating systems such as iOS or Android are used on smartphones and tablets. Embedded operating systems are used in medical equipment, industrial robots, televisions, home appliances such as washing machines, etc., while server-based operating systems are used in servers hosting websites or other services over a network. Finally, real-time operating systems are designed to respond quickly to specific events within a predetermined period of time.

Ingredients
This oatmeal cookie recipe requires 2 1/2 cups of all-purpose flour, 1 teaspoon of baking soda, 1 teaspoon of ground cinnamon, 1/2 teaspoon of salt, and 1 cup (2 sticks) of unsalted butter softened. Additionally, you’ll need 3/4 cup of packed light-brown sugar, 3/4 cup of granulated sugar, 2 large eggs, and 1 teaspoon of pure vanilla extract. For the oatmeal cookie topping you’ll need 2 cups of old-fashioned rolled oats and 1/2 cup (1 stick) of unsalted butter melted. You can also add up to 3 tablespoons of granulated sugar for an extra sweet treat.
Instructions
Begin by preheating your oven to 350°F with the oven rack in the center position. In a medium bowl combine the flour, baking soda, cinnamon, and salt. In a separate large bowl beat the butter and both sugars on medium speed until light and fluffy. Add the eggs one at a time beating well after each addition then add the vanilla extract and beat until combined. Gradually add in the dry ingredients while beating on low speed until just combined. Finally stir in the oats then cover with plastic wrap or beeswax wrap and refrigerate for 30 minutes or longer.
Using a medium cookie scoop make balls out of the dough then place them on an ungreased baking sheet about 2 inches apart from one another. Bake for 10 minutes then remove from oven and let cool on ba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ring to a cooling rack to cool completely.
In a small bowl whisk together the melted butter with up to 3 tablespoons of granulated sugar if desired then brush over each cooled cookie before serving or storing in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 5 days.
What is E-Commerce?
E-commerce is the buying and selling of goods and services, or the transmitting of funds or data, over an electronic network, primarily the internet. These business transactions occur either business-to-business (B2B), business-to-consumer (B2C), consumer-to-consumer (C2C) or consumer-to-business (C2B). The terms e-commerce and e-business are often used interchangeably. The difference between them is that e-commerce refers to the entire online process of buying and selling goods and services, while e-business refers to any process that a company carries out over a computer network.
Advantages of E-Commerce
E-commerce has several advantages for businesses such as lower costs due to fewer intermediaries, increased speed of transaction processing, improved customer service and higher customer loyalty. Consumers benefit from a wider range of products at competitive prices due to lower overhead expenses for businesses. Additionally, consumers have access to more information about products which helps them make better purchase decisions. Moreover, customers can shop 24/7 from any location with an internet connection.
Types of E-Commerce
The four main types of eCommerce are: business to consumer (B2C), business to business (B2B), consumer to consumer (C2C) and consumer to business (C2B).
- Business To Consumer: In this type of eCommerce model, businesses sell products directly to consumers.
- Business To Business: In this type of eCommerce model, businesses sell products or services to other businesses.
- Consumer To Consumer: In this model, individuals buy and sell products directly with each other.
- Consumer To Business: In this model, individuals sell goods or services directly back to businesses.
